Is your coffee organic?

Sometimes the coffee we feature is organic, and other times it is not. Coffee is a tricky crop when it comes to organic certification, because obtaining and maintaining the certification can be quite the financial burden on the farm, even if they are

How fresh is the coffee?

Our ground and whole bean coffee is roasted the very same day it is shipped, oftentimes within just a few hours! Our pods are roasted just a few days prior to shipping, allowing them proper time to degas before being shipped. This helps us prevent se

How much coffee comes in each bag?

We offer both 12oz and 6oz bag options for monthly subscriptions and 12oz bags for gift subscriptions. Each 12oz bag will serve about 30 cups of coffee.

Can I brew with a Keurig or use a K Cup?

Yes, our coffee can be used to brew in a reusable K Cup basket! We recommend using a ratio of 1 tsp of coffee per ounce of water. We do also offer a pre-portioned pod option, which are compatible with most Keurig 1.0 and 2.0 machines.

How do I open your bags?

There will be a pull tab located on the left side of the bag that can be torn away for easy opening! At times that pull tab can blend in with our colorful bag design, so be sure to keep an eye out for it.
